Establishes the "Prescription Drug Savings and Transparency Act of 2026" to evaluate consolidated prescription drug management within Medicaid.
The "Prescription Drug Savings and Transparency Act of 2026" mandates an independent study by the office of the auditor general to assess whether Rhode Island would benefit from adopting a consolidated prescription drug management program within the Medicaid program. The study will compare various prescription drug management structures, including administration through managed care organizations, a single statewide preferred drug list, and a single state-contracted pharmacy benefit manager.
